Salvia mexicana 'Limelight'
Mexican Sage
Salvia mexicana 'Limelight'
Description
Code: 8589Family: LamiaceaeGenus: Salvia
Plant Type:Shrub
This salvia is absolutely electrifying. Very tall spikes emerge with bright neon green calyxes along densely packed panicles which later produce tomentose, indigo buds that develop into long, tubular, blue-violet blooms. It is a spectacle in the garden when fully formed because of it's size, form, and incredible color combination. An excellent stand alone specimen for any cottage garden or butterfly garden.
Blooms: Summer
Summer
Growth Rate: Moderate
Size Range: 3-4' tall x 2-3' wide
Cultural Information
Exposure
Sun Sun
Soil: Average,Well-drained
Water Use: Drought Tolerant,Low
Maintenance: Medium
Hardiness Zone: 8,11
Cold Hardy to 10° to 20°F
